Key Agencies and Standards

NASA-STD-8739.4: NASA’s Workmanship Standard for Crimping, Interconnecting Cables, Harnesses, and Wiring.

ECSS-Q-ST-70-26C: European Cooperation for Space Standardization (ESA), focused on wire wrapping and harness requirements.

IPC/WHMA-A-620: Industry consensus standard, widely used as a base for aerospace-specific addendums.

Materials and Component Requirements

Wire Insulation: ETFE, Ptfe, and Kapton are commonly used for their heat resistance and dielectric strength.

Conectores: Space-rated, MIL-spec connectors with locking mechanisms.

Shielding: EMI/RFI protection via braided or foil shielding.

Assembly and Fabrication Guidelines

Crimping vs Soldering: NASA and ESA favor crimped connections for reliability.

Routing and Lacing: Must avoid sharp bends and use lacing cords instead of zip ties.

Strain Relief: Critical for mitigating launch and vibration stresses.

Testing Protocols

Continuity and Insulation Resistance: 100% verification.

HiPot Testing: Ensures insulation can withstand voltage spikes.

Outgassing Tests: For all non-metallic materials.

Vibration and Shock Testing: Simulates launch environments.
